About this product
Opening tins shouldn't be a struggle, and the Cookworks Can Opener makes it completely effortless. With 60 watts of power, it tackles any size tin in seconds - whether you're cracking open a can of soup, baked beans, or tinned tomatoes for dinner. Brilliant for anyone who finds manual openers tricky or tiring, especially if you've got stiff hands or weak grip. The magnetic lid holder catches the lid safely so it doesn't drop into your food, and there's a built-in bottle opener too, so you've got everything covered in one handy gadget.
The simple blade release means cleaning up is safe and straightforward - no fiddling with sharp edges. Auto shut-off kicks in once the job's done, so you don't have to worry about it running on. Cord storage keeps your worktop tidy when it's not in use, and the integrated knife sharpener is a nice bonus for keeping your kitchen knives in top condition. Backed by a 1-year manufacturer's guarantee, it's a practical little helper that takes the hassle out of opening tins and bottles.
